Wheel of Love [Tokio Hotel, TB, Bill/Andreas, PG-13]

Wheel of Love by emraud
Bill Kaulitz, a 25 year-old Production artist (and freelance graphic designer) works at an advertising company. He's an efficient worker, doing a great job in his field. But when he's at home, he's an ultimate potato couch, leaving mess everywhere around the house.
Tom Trumper's marriage is on hiatus, and thus decided for a temporary separation. He moved back to his old house, only to dive in to a mountain of mess (metaphorically and literally) as he witness the life of a young father and daughter.

Anyways. The plot is how Tom is getting divorced from his wife and is moving back to his childhood home. But it isnt so simple. His dad isnt there but Bill is. Bill with his beautiful daughter Gillian. They start weird life together where Bill tries to find a good partner for him and a good parent for Gillian. And the same time Gillian starts to call Tom dada. Somewhere along all that Tom falls for Bill and the mess is complete.
